Clearly Define the Role and Responsibilities
- Key Responsibilities: A Python Developer Google in medium to large businesses is responsible for designing, developing, testing, and deploying Python-based applications that integrate with Google's platforms, such as Google Cloud Platform (GCP), Google Workspace, and various APIs. They work on backend systems, data pipelines, automation scripts, and cloud-native applications. Typical duties include writing clean and efficient code, optimizing performance, ensuring security compliance, collaborating with DevOps teams, and troubleshooting production issues. In addition, they may be tasked with implementing machine learning models, managing databases, and creating RESTful APIs to support web and mobile applications.
- Experience Levels: Junior Python Developer Googles typically have 0-2 years of experience and focus on coding, debugging, and supporting senior team members. Mid-level developers, with 2-5 years of experience, take on more complex tasks, contribute to architectural decisions, and may mentor juniors. Senior Python Developer Googles, with 5+ years of experience, lead projects, design system architecture, drive technical innovation, and often serve as the bridge between technical teams and business stakeholders. Senior roles require deep expertise in Python, cloud integration, and scalable system design.
- Company Fit: In medium-sized companies (50-500 employees), Python Developer Googles often wear multiple hats, working closely with cross-functional teams and adapting to a dynamic environment. They may be involved in both development and operations, requiring versatility and strong communication skills. In large enterprises (500+ employees), roles tend to be more specialized, with developers focusing on specific domains such as cloud infrastructure, data engineering, or automation. Large organizations may also require experience with enterprise-level tools, compliance standards, and the ability to navigate complex organizational structures.
Certifications
Certifications play a significant role in validating the expertise of Python Developer Googles, especially when assessing candidates for medium to large organizations. Industry-recognized certifications demonstrate a candidate's commitment to professional growth and their proficiency in both Python programming and Google's ecosystem.
One of the most valuable certifications is the Google Professional Cloud Developer, issued by Google Cloud. This certification validates a developer's ability to build scalable and highly available applications using Google Cloud technologies. Candidates must pass a rigorous exam covering topics such as cloud-native application development, integrating Google Cloud services, managing application performance, and ensuring security. This credential is particularly valuable for organizations leveraging GCP for their infrastructure and services.
Another relevant certification is the PCAP “ Certified Associate in Python Programming, offered by the Python Institute. This certification assesses a candidate's understanding of Python fundamentals, including data structures, object-oriented programming, and error handling. For more advanced roles, the PCEP “ Certified Entry-Level Python Programmer and PCPP “ Certified Professional in Python Programming provide further validation of expertise in advanced Python concepts, libraries, and best practices.
For developers working in data science or machine learning, certifications such as the Google Professional Data Engineer or TensorFlow Developer Certificate can be highly advantageous. These credentials demonstrate proficiency in building data pipelines, deploying machine learning models, and integrating with Google's AI and analytics tools.

Assess Technical Skills
- Tools and Software: Python Developer Googles should be proficient in core Python programming, including popular frameworks such as Django, Flask, and FastAPI. Experience with Google Cloud Platform (GCP) services”such as App Engine, Cloud Functions, BigQuery, and Cloud Storage”is essential for roles focused on cloud integration. Familiarity with containerization tools like Docker and orchestration platforms like Kubernetes is increasingly important for deploying scalable applications. Developers should also be comfortable with version control systems (e.g., Git), CI/CD pipelines, and infrastructure-as-code tools such as Terraform. Knowledge of RESTful API design, SQL and NoSQL databases (e.g., PostgreSQL, Firestore), and data processing libraries (e.g., Pandas, NumPy) is highly valuable.
- Assessments: Evaluating technical proficiency requires a combination of methods. Coding assessments, such as timed programming challenges or take-home projects, allow candidates to demonstrate problem-solving skills and code quality. Technical interviews should include questions on Python syntax, algorithms, and system design, as well as practical scenarios involving Google Cloud integration. Pair programming sessions or live coding exercises can provide insights into a candidate's thought process and collaboration style. For senior roles, consider reviewing candidate's contributions to open-source projects or requesting code samples from previous work.

Conduct Thorough Background and Reference Checks
Conducting a thorough background check is a vital step in hiring a Python Developer Google Employee, ensuring that the candidate's credentials and experience align with your organization's needs. Begin by verifying employment history through direct contact with previous employers. Confirm the candidate's job titles, dates of employment, and specific responsibilities to ensure accuracy and consistency with their resume. Requesting references from former managers or colleagues can provide valuable insights into the candidate's technical abilities, work ethic, and collaboration skills.
Certification verification is equally important, especially for roles requiring specialized knowledge of Python or Google Cloud technologies. Ask candidates to provide digital copies of their certificates or verification links from the issuing organizations. For high-stakes positions, consider using third-party background check services that can authenticate credentials and flag any discrepancies.
In addition to employment and certification checks, evaluate the candidate's online presence, such as contributions to open-source projects, technical blogs, or professional profiles. This can offer a deeper understanding of their expertise and engagement with the developer community. For roles with access to sensitive data or critical infrastructure, conduct standard criminal background checks and ensure compliance with industry-specific regulations. By performing comprehensive due diligence, you reduce the risk of hiring mismatches and safeguard your organization's reputation and assets.
Offer Competitive Compensation and Benefits
- Market Rates: Compensation for Python Developer Googles varies based on experience, location, and industry. As of 2024, junior developers typically earn between $80,000 and $110,000 annually in major U.S. tech hubs. Mid-level developers command salaries in the range of $110,000 to $140,000, while senior Python Developer Googles with extensive Google Cloud expertise can earn $150,000 to $200,000 or more, especially in high-demand markets such as San Francisco, New York, and Seattle. Remote roles may offer competitive pay to attract talent from a broader geographic pool. In addition to base salary, many organizations provide performance bonuses, stock options, and other financial incentives to retain top performers.

Provide Onboarding and Continuous Development
Effective onboarding is essential for ensuring the long-term success and integration of a new Python Developer Google Employee. Begin by providing a structured orientation that introduces the company culture, mission, and values, as well as key policies and procedures. Assign a dedicated mentor or onboarding buddy to guide the new hire through their first weeks, answer questions, and facilitate introductions to team members and stakeholders.
Equip the new developer with all necessary hardware, software, and access credentials before their start date to ensure a smooth transition. Provide comprehensive documentation on codebases, development workflows, and deployment processes. Schedule training sessions on internal tools, Google Cloud services, and security protocols relevant to their role. Encourage participation in team meetings, code reviews, and collaborative projects to foster a sense of belonging and accelerate learning.
Set clear performance expectations and short-term goals, with regular check-ins to monitor progress and address any challenges. Solicit feedback from the new hire to continuously improve the onboarding process.
